Your mission, roles and responsibilities
As a Quality Laboratory Trainee Technician, you will analyze products to ensure compliance and support problem-solving initiatives within the production environment
Key Responsibilities:
Create and validate instructions for measuring equipment, including R&R studies.
Conduct laboratory and special measurements, such as macrography, for:
Incoming inspections according to the control plan
PPAP parts (customer and supplier)
Product audits and QRCI analyses
Sampling inspections and process trials
Ensure 3D measurements comply with relevant national and international standards.
Manage calibration plans and R&R studies for measuring equipment (planning, execution, documentation).
Perform product audits (macrography, layout inspection, etc.).
Escalate non-conforming products or risks to the Customer & Production Quality Assurance and Quality Manager.

FORVIA is an automotive technology group at the heart of smarter and more sustainable mobility. We bring together expertise in electronics, clean mobility, lighting, interiors, seating, and lifecycle solutions to drive change in the automotive industry.
With a history stretching back more than a century, we are the 7th largest global automotive supplier, employing more than 157,000 people in 43 countries. You'll find our technology in around 1 out of 2 vehicles produced anywhere in the world.
In June 2022, we became the 1st global automotive group to be certified with the SBTI Net-Zero Standard. We have committed to reach CO2 Net Zero by no later than 2045.
